Pressure washing is usually used to clean buildings, paved surfaces and equipment on school. Nonetheless, stress cleaning can adversely impact water quality otherwise done correctly. Usage completely dry methods such as brooms, blowers or road sweepers to cleanse the location prior to utilizing a pressure washer on any type of surface. Block off storm drains first to prevent debris from entering.


EHS has actually typically discovered that using chemicals does not improve the outcome. Expense cost savings can be considerable without using chemicals, since the wastewater usually does not require to be captured and delivered to a disposal center. If a chemical cleaner must be utilized for stress washing, take the complying with steps: Get in touch with EHS to get a map of the tornado drains around the job website.



This can involve tarpaulins, berms, storm drain covers or mats, pipeline plugs, pumps, etc. The other alternative is to gather the wastewater in a drum or container and eliminate offsite for disposal at an accredited wastewater facility.

Stress cleaning in some areas require extra precautions to guarantee that the materials being washed do not go into the tornado drainpipe system.


Overflow from those locations need to be recorded and not enabled to release right into tornado drains. Oil and food waste that splashes or sprinkles onto the ground needs to be cleaned up utilizing dry techniques such as absorbing materials or shop vacs. If degreaser will certainly be called for, contact EHS for aid with a clean-up plan that will consist of blocking the storm drains and gathering wastewater.




Loading dock trench drains pipes and floor drains pipes connected to the tornado drain system: Do not pressure clean grease or food waste off of these filling docks. If stress washing is required to clean spills, get in touch with EHS for a clean-up plan that will entail blocking the drains pipes and gathering wastewater. Examine for leaking dumpsters or lorry fluid spills or leakages.


(https://www.twitch.tv/martzpwashing/about)If the packing dock is or else without fluid contamination, adhere to the stress cleaning steps detailed above. Sediment tracked off building sites of any size must not be cleaned into storm drains pipes. Debris needs to be cleaned up utilizing only completely dry approaches (street sweeper, brooms, shovels, etc).
